A cyst is a fluid filled capsule, and can appear anywhere on your body. They are usually harmless, but can be quite painful, like an underground pimple is painful, because it places pressure on surrounding tissues, depending on where they are, and whether they are growing. When they burst, there is often relief. Some cysts, like in your breast, can be bad, because they might have cancer cells in them. Cystic ovaries are common in women. They tend
to come and go, dissolving on their own.
Unless the cyst grows beyond a certain size,
they are usually left alone.
If the condition causes pain, meds can be given
to inhibit their growth.
Ovarian Cysts have no negative effect on
furture pregnancies.
